Christian Alexander Haider is a researcher at University of Applied Sciences Hagenberg, affiliated with the Research Center Hagenberg and multiple Centers of Excellence including Logistics, Smart Production, Digital Transformation, and ICT. His work focuses on developing advanced computational methods for practical applications in logistics and production systems.
Haider's research interests center around symbolic regression techniques with particular emphasis on shape-constrained models that incorporate domain knowledge. His work addresses critical challenges in constraint evaluation, simulation optimization, and the Physical Internet concept. He develops methods that ensure regression models respect physical constraints while maintaining accuracy, which is crucial for real-world engineering applications where model violations could have serious consequences.
Analysis of his publication trends from 2022-2025 reveals a consistent focus on improving symbolic regression methodologies. His research has evolved from basic constraint evaluation techniques to sophisticated multi-objective approaches that balance multiple competing requirements in model building. The applications span diverse fields including magnetization processes, extrusion manufacturing, and data validation systems, demonstrating the versatility of his methodological contributions.
Haider has been actively involved in multiple research projects including:
- FinCoM - Financial Condition Monitoring (2022-2023)
- Josef Ressel Zentrum für Symbolische Regression (2018-2022)
- DigiVent - Predictive Maintenance für Industrie-Radialventilatoren (2017-2020)
- K.I. für E-Mails (2017-2019)
- ATROPINE - Fast Track to the Physical Internet (2016-2018)
His work is conducted within the Center of Excellence Logistics and Center of Excellence for Smart Production, where he collaborates with researchers across disciplines to develop solutions for complex logistical challenges using advanced computational techniques.
